Thursday, January 12
ANC6A meets at 7:00pm, at Miner Elementary, 601 Fifteenth Street, NE.
Among items on the draft agenda:
Election of officers and committee chairs.
Presentations: RFK Campus Redevelopment Project Update – Max Brown, Chairman, Events DC.
U.S. Attorney’s Safety & Criminal Justice Update – Doug Klein, Community Prosecutor.
Letter approving Settlement Agreement with Bespoke 1337 LLC, t/a Hill Prince, at 1337 H Street, NE.
Letter approving Settlement Agreement Naomi’s Ladder II LLC, at 1123 H Street, NE.
Support of a stipulated license for Naomi’s Ladder II LLC, at 1123 H Street, NE.
Letter approving Settlement Agreement with Ben’s Chili Bowl/Ben’s Upstairs, at 1001 H Street, NE, and withdrawal of protest of the establishment’s license application and request for an Entertainment Endorsement.
Letter of support for the 2017 Rock and Roll Marathon and Half-Marathon contingent on the provision of the following conditions:
A summary and description of the usage and location of TCOs in or adjacent to ANC 6A; a description of the door hanger campaign and which neighborhoods in ANC 6A will receive door hangers, including a quality control program to ensure the door hangers are not left in front yards; a description of the location of crossings along parts of the route in ANC 6A; a description of the bus stop and/or bus notification campaign for X2, 90 and 92 buses; confirmation that the Tenth (10th) Street NE checkpoint will be open to allow Capitol Hill Towers residents to access their parking lot entrance on 10th Street; confirmation that staging of Department of Public Works (DPW) trucks will be at RFK Stadium and not on neighborhood streets; notification of any other ANCs that express opposition to the event and the reasons for the opposition.
